Abstract

The invention relates to a construction method, in particular to a construction method for reinforcing a grade beam, which solves the problem of further reinforcement of a ground foundation after a surface building is heightened in the prior construction method. The construction method for reinforcing the grade beam comprises the following steps: firstly, two main ribs are laid in parallel on the upper side face of a foundation beam and pass through a foundation column which is connected with the foundation beam; secondly, vertical ribs are laid on two outer side faces of the foundation beam; thirdly, short ribs are vertically embedded into the upper side face and the two side faces of the foundation beam, hoop reinforcements are arranged outside the main ribs and the vertical ribs, and both ends of the hoop reinforcements are embedded into a foundation seat of the foundation beam; fourthly, bonding ribs are arranged between adjacent vertical ribs, and the main ribs, the vertical ribs, the short ribs and the hoop reinforcements are bound to form a reinforcing mat; and fifthly, concrete is placed on an external template of the reinforcing mat formed. The construction method mainly has the characteristics that thickening construction treatment is performed on the basis of the prior foundation beam, and a thickened layer is closely connected with the prior foundation beam, so that the loading capacity of the foundation beam is increased and the construction method is suitable for heightening of surface buildings.

Description

technical field [0001] The invention relates to a building construction method, in particular to a foundation beam reinforcement construction method. Background technique [0002] The structure of a high-rise building can basically be divided into the building part on the ground and the basic building part under the bottom surface. It is located at the lower part of the wall column, which bears all the load on the upper part of the building and transmits it to the foundation. When building relatively large industrial and civil buildings, if the weak soil layer of the foundation is thick, the shallow buried foundation cannot meet the strength and deformation requirements of the foundation, and pile foundations are often used. The function of the pile foundation is to transfer the load to the deep hard soil layer through the pile, or to the foundation through the friction around the pile.
